Myself and 3 mates went to Arsenal v Stoke earlier in the season. I got the impression that due to their bad start Arsenal weren't selling out games like they used to and this is the first season that tickets have been going on general sale to the public. So just register and hope that the return of Henry isn't pushing demand back up. Keep an eye on the site for the day they move from members only to general sale.
